合肥学院通信工程:5B6B译码仿真与MATLAB实现

版权申诉
0 下载量 105 浏览量 更新于2024-06-29 收藏 985KB PDF 举报
在"合肥学院通信工程专业课程设计报告——5B6B译码的仿真与实现"中,学生深入研究了5B6B编码在光纤通信系统中的重要性。5B6B码,作为一种mBnB线路码型,因其具有低误码率、高容量传输以及优良的同步性和误码监测特性,被广泛应用于高速光纤通信系统中。该课题旨在通过理论学习和实践操作,使学生掌握5B6B译码的工作原理。 设计目标包括: 1. 理解5B6B译码原理:学生需首先掌握5B6B码的编码规则,即如何将6B数据转换为5B数据,理解这种码型转换背后的逻辑和优势。 2. 仿真模型设计:学生需利用MATLAB软件创建一个5B6B译码的仿真模型,通过模拟实际通信环境,测试译码器的性能和有效性。 3. 硬件实现:使用MATLAB或硬件描述语言(如Verilog HDL)设计并实现5B6B译码器,通过对各个模块的分析和仿真,确保其正确无误。 4. 文档编写:设计过程中需要绘制系统框图、电路原理图和软件流程图,以及模拟仿真结果图,这些图形化展示有助于清晰地呈现设计思路和结果。 在项目计划阶段,团队分工明确,三人协作完成任务。在第12周,学生会查阅相关文献,如李勇权等人的文章,了解5B6B译码的具体实现方法和技术背景。第13周则专注于实际操作,进行5B6B译码器的设计和仿真实验,并撰写课程设计报告。 参考文献引用了多篇学术论文,展示了当前在5B6B编解码方面的研究成果,例如基于FPGA的实现方法,这表明学生们在设计过程中不仅关注理论,还注重结合实际硬件平台进行实践。 这份课程设计要求学生综合运用理论知识和实际技能,对5B6B译码器进行深入理解和实现,提升他们对光纤通信系统工作原理的掌握,以及运用现代电子设计工具进行数字信号处理的能力。